Overview of the Core Event
The fifth and final season of the critically acclaimed series *Hacks* premiered on Sky Atlantic, continuing the story of Deborah Vance, portrayed by Jean Smart. The season opens with Deborah determined to "shift the narrative" surrounding her career, as she embarks on ambitious projects aimed at revitalizing her public image, including a Grammy and an Oscar bid.

Plot Developments
In the opening double bill, Deborah's efforts include a unique strategy involving a "Mexican music album." The narrative explores her challenges, including a poorly received autograph signing session, which underscores her struggles to maintain relevance in a changing entertainment landscape.
Broader Context
The series has been praised for its exploration of themes such as aging in the entertainment industry and the evolving dynamics of fame. As Deborah grapples with her legacy, the show reflects broader societal issues regarding the treatment of older artists and the pressures they face to adapt.
